Details of Urban Adventure in Istanbul: Home Cooked Istanbul

Experience authentic Turkish life on an evening spent mixing with locals in popular, traditional haunts, plus a wonderful meal in the home of a local family. Met by an expert local guide at your hotel, you'll head out along the historic streets of Sultanahmet. The hospitality of the Turkish people is known throughout the world and tonight you'll get the chance to experience it first hand: meet a local family and sit down for a typical Turkish meal - only a little English is spoken in the household but your guide will be able to translate and allow you to get to know your hosts. You'll be able to enjoy conversations with different members of the family and find out what it is like to live in contemporary Turkey. This chance to share a meal cooked by a local family is a true privilege and an opportunity to get real insight into local family life.

After we finish our delicious feast, we'll take a wander around the backstreets. Have your camera at the ready to take snaps of the exquisite, traditional wooden houses that line the narrow lanes (in various states of repair). You'll be able to get a taste of the community-focused lifestyle led in Istanbul and learn about the many socio-economic groups that live here. Next, we'll head on to a popular local teahouse which boasts stunning views of the Sea of Marmara - we'll get a comfortable spot to watch games of football pop-up or engage in conversation with the locals, plus you'll get the chance to play backgammon - and if you don’t know the rules or how to play our local guide will be only too happy to show you.

Afterwards you'll have the opportunity to try two of Turkey’s favourite pastimes - drinking tea and smoking Narglie (waterpipe), so just sit back, relax and enjoy. At the end of the adventure you'll be free to return to your hotel or continue your own personal exploration of Istanbul - your guide will be able to suggest a range of different places to spend the rest of the evening.
